Considered in isolation, the comments in the last chapter would give bountiful gifts to the critic of sport. Those wishing to denigrate the part played by sport and hoping to reveal the way in which too much involvement in sport interferes significantly with other aspects of education would look at my examples as support for the view that sport is over-emphasized in schools and the effect this has on education standards is, overall, negative. To many this has become a self-evident article of faith, particularly as many black kids fare well in sport but not in other academic areas.
